/* Flot plugin for rendering pie charts.
Copyright (c) 2007-2014 IOLA and Ole Laursen.
Licensed under the MIT license.
The plugin assumes that each series has a single data value, and that each
value is a positive integer or zero. Negative numbers don't make sense for a
pie chart, and have unpredictable results. The values do NOT need to be
passed in as percentages; the plugin will calculate the total and per-slice
percentages internally.
* Created by Brian Medendorp
* Updated with contributions from btburnett3, Anthony Aragues and Xavi Ivars
The plugin supports these options:
series: {
pie: {
show: true/false
radius: 0-1 for percentage of fullsize, or a specified pixel length, or 'auto'
innerRadius: 0-1 for percentage of fullsize or a specified pixel length, for creating a donut effect
startAngle: 0-2 factor of PI used for starting angle (in radians) i.e 3/2 starts at the top, 0 and 2 have the same result
tilt: 0-1 for percentage to tilt the pie, where 1 is no tilt, and 0 is completely flat (nothing will show)
offset: {
top: integer value to move the pie up or down
left: integer value to move the pie left or right, or 'auto'
},
stroke: {
color: any hexidecimal color value (other formats may or may not work, so best to stick with something like '#FFF')
width: integer pixel width of the stroke
},
label: {
show: true/false, or 'auto'
formatter: a user-defined function that modifies the text/style of the label text
radius: 0-1 for percentage of fullsize, or a specified pixel length
background: {
color: any hexidecimal color value (other formats may or may not work, so best to stick with something like '#000')
opacity: 0-1
},
threshold: 0-1 for the percentage value at which to hide labels (if they're too small)
},
combine: {
threshold: 0-1 for the percentage value at which to combine slices (if they're too small)
color: any hexidecimal color value (other formats may or may not work, so best to stick with something like '#CCC'), if null, the plugin will automatically use the color of the first slice to be combined
label: any text value of what the combined slice should be labeled
}
highlight: {
opacity: 0-1
}
}
}
More detail and specific examples can be found in the included HTML file.
*/

/* Flot plugin for stacking data sets rather than overlyaing them.
Copyright (c) 2007-2014 IOLA and Ole Laursen.
Licensed under the MIT license.
The plugin assumes the data is sorted on x (or y if stacking horizontally).
For line charts, it is assumed that if a line has an undefined gap (from a
null point), then the line above it should have the same gap - insert zeros
instead of "null" if you want another behaviour. This also holds for the start
and end of the chart. Note that stacking a mix of positive and negative values
in most instances doesn't make sense (so it looks weird).
Two or more series are stacked when their "stack" attribute is set to the same
key (which can be any number or string or just "true"). To specify the default
stack, you can set the stack option like this:
series: {
stack: null/false, true, or a key (number/string)
}
You can also specify it for a single series, like this:
$.plot( $("#placeholder"), [{
data: [ ... ],
stack: true
}])
The stacking order is determined by the order of the data series in the array
(later series end up on top of the previous).
Internally, the plugin modifies the datapoints in each series, adding an
offset to the y value. For line series, extra data points are inserted through
interpolation. If there's a second y value, it's also adjusted (e.g for bar
charts or filled areas).
*/
